How ⁤to Choose the Right ‌CNA Program in Augusta GA

Picking​ the ideal CNA ⁤program involves considering several factors:

  1. Accreditation and Approval: Ensure ​the program is approved by Georgia DCH for certification eligibility.
  2. Cost and Financial Aid: ‍ Check tuition fees and whether scholarships or payment plans⁤ are⁢ available.
  3. Class Schedule and Location: Opt for programs offering flexible scheduling or⁤ online components if needed.
  4. Reputation ‍and Reviews: Research student reviews and success rates for program graduates.
  5. Clinical Experience: ‌Hands-on practice is crucial-ensure the program ‌offers ample ​clinical hours in real healthcare ⁤settings.

Passing the CNA Certification exam in Augusta GA

After completing your CNA training, the next step is ⁢to pass the​ Georgia CNA certification exam. Here’s what ⁣you need to know:

  • Exam Components: Consists of a written test and a skills demonstration.
  • Planning Tips: Review ⁣course materials, take practice tests, and attend review sessions.
  • Scheduling: Register early through Pearson VUE testing centers in‌ Augusta.
  • Exam Cost: typically around $100-$125, payable at registration.
